Capturing candid moments and heartfelt performances throughout a long Ram Road Trip, Levi Hummon has started 4th of July celebrations early.

How did he celebrate? By releasing his “Guts And Glory” music video! Directed by Brian Lazarro and shot in some of America’s most beautiful locations, the video highlights Hummon’s dynamic vocals both onstage and countryside.

The CMT Listen Up artist racked up miles in Ram pickup trucks as he traveled to a dozen U.S. cities including Los Angeles, New York, Detroit, Minneapolis and Austin. Hummon donated his time to local philanthropic causes including delivering bottled water to Flint, MI and sang tracks from his self-titled EP amidst scenic performance backdrops gathering fans along the way.

Hummon said,

Seeing our journey laid out in such a beautiful way by Brian Lazarro is just unreal. I love that we have this video to share with our fans and we’re able to tell an American story just in time for Fourth of July. The video compliments ‘Guts And Glory’ so well and is a testament to the #GutsGloryRam and Ram Trucks lifestyle.

The video adds to Hummon’s growing list of accolades, which includes a feature as one of Rolling Stone’s “Artists You Need to Know” as well as an “Artist to Watch” by The Huffington Post. Hummon is continuing life on the road even after the tour’s wrap as he opens for Billy Currington on select dates of his Summer Forever tour.
